Windows Std Serial Comm Lib for Delphi 7.0

Licença: Avaliação gratuita ‎Tamanho do arquivo: 1.59 MB
‎Classificação dos usuários: 3.0/5 - ‎2 ‎Votos

MarshallSoft Delphi biblioteca de componentes de comunicações seriais para portas seriais RS232 e multi-drop RS485 e RS422. Use o WSC4D para escrever aplicativos para acessar dados de dispositivos seriais como scanners de código de barras, modems, instrumentos de laboratório, dispositivos médicos, dispositivos seriais USB, escalas, navegação GPS, scanners de impressões digitais, servidores de impressora, etc. As características do WSC4D incluem: - Suporta 256 portas. Pode controlar várias portas simultaneamente. - Totalmente seguro para rosca, re-entrante da porta, controle de modem, status e controle da linha serial e emulação ANSI. - Usa a API padrão do Windows para se comunicar com qualquer dispositivo conectado a uma porta serial RS232. - Suporta portas seriais virtuais (USB para conversor serial, série Bluetooth). - Xmodem e Ymodem conduzidos pelo Estado em várias portas simultaneamente (até 256 conexões). - Pode enviar mensagens do Windows na conclusão dos eventos (caractere de entrada, etc.). - Inclui 52 funções mais controle de modem. - Suporta qualquer taxa de baud. - Capacidade de especificar a paridade, o tamanho da palavra e o número de bits de parada. - Inclui vários programas de exemplo de Delfos. - Inclui DLLs de 32 bits e 64 bits. - Suporta todas as compilações Delphi de 32 bits e 64 bits de Delphi 4 até Delphi XE8 e Delphi Seattle e Berlim. - Não depende de bibliotecas de apoio. Faz chamadas apenas para funções de API do Windows. - O mesmo WSC32. DLL e WSC64. O DLL pode ser usado a partir de qualquer linguagem suportada (C/C++, Delphi, Visual Basic, PowerBASIC, Visual FoxPro, Visual dBase, Xbase++, COBOL). - A licença abrange todas as linguagens de programação. - Distribuição gratuita de royalties com um aplicativo compilado. - O código fonte está disponível. - Suporte técnico gratuito e atualizações por um ano. - Documentação completa. Suporta Windows XP, Vista, Win7, Win8, Win10. - Versão de avaliação totalmente funcional.

história da versão

  • Versão 7.0 postado em 2019-10-03
    SioGets fixo() - nunca intervalos quando a I/O sobreposta foi ativada. Adicionado SioOpen e SioClose. Adicionado SioGetsQ - lê porta até que nenhum dado de entrada para especificado "quiet" tempo. Adicionados exemplos de programas Scale.c e vc_Scale.cpp que lêem a partir de uma escala (serial).
  • Versão 6.0.1 postado em 2017-04-06
    Adicionados códigos de erro adicionais. Adicionado SioErrorText() que retorna texto associado a códigos de erro especificados. Adicionado SioPortInfo() que retorna baud em BPS e no cps porta teórica. Adicionado SioGetsC() que recebe uma linha inteira através do caractere stop (EOL). Programa de exemplo ReadGPS adicionado.
  • Versão 5.4.1 postado em 2015-09-09
    Adicionado SioCRC16 e funções SioCRC32 para calcular CCITT CRC de 16 bits ou CCITT CRC de 32 bits.
  • Versão 4.2 postado em 2006-03-06

Detalhes do programa

Eula

EULA - Contrato de Licença do Usuário Final

A MarshallSoft Computing, Inc. concede uma licença não exclusiva para usar o SOFTWARE ao comprador original para fins de projetar, testar ou desenvolver aplicativos de software. As cópias podem ser feitas apenas para fins de backup ou arquivamento. Este produto é licenciado para uso por apenas um desenvolvedor por vez. A DLL comprada com o desconto acadêmico não pode ser distribuída, e deve ser usada apenas para fins educacionais. O SOFTWARE pertence à MarshallSoft Computing, Inc. e é protegido por leis de direitos autorais dos Estados Unidos e disposições de tratados internacionais. Este SOFTWARE está sendo licenciado e não vendido. Este SOFTWARE é fornecido "como está". A MarshallSoft Computing não faz nenhuma garantia, expressa ou implícita, em relação ao software. Todas as garantias implícitas, incluindo as garantias de comercialização e adequação para um determinado uso são excluídas. A RESPONSABILIDADE DO SOFTWARE DE COMPUTAÇÃO MARSHALLSOFT ESTÁ LIMITADA AO PREÇO DE COMPRA. Em nenhuma circunstância a MarshallSoft Computing será responsável por quaisquer danos incidentais ou consequentes, nem por qualquer dano superior ao preço de compra original.